Output 5da6517b03542099bce94da5667ee75ece1a414913c471379d9ea9880c77b8ed:31

value
1437608
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c02c8a32e6e37648b837bd24f7c1d148d75faffa OP_EQUAL
address
DNfDdmjoa8cz51HR3wgsXMrkFzt5KvUm9Y
transaction
5da6517b03542099bce94da5667ee75ece1a414913c471379d9ea9880c77b8ed
spent
true